Ingredients and Cost:

RECIPE COST: $2.99

PER SERVING COST: $1.50

Pink dragonfruit — feel free to use fresh or frozen fruit. If you can’t find pink dragonfruit, you can also use the white-flesh varieties, also known as Pitaya Blanca. 3/4 cup for about $1.32.

Maple syrup — this ingredient is completely flexible. You can use honey, agave nectar, or brown rice syrup. All would work well in this recipe. 1/4 cup pure maple syrup for about $1.10.

Lemons — gives a bright and tangy flavor component. 1/2 cup fresh lemon juice for about $0.52.

A herbal or green tea bag — adds all of the benefits of green tea, and adds the perfect light floral taste we all love. 1 tea bag for about $0.05.

Recipe Variations

  • You can use herbal or green tea in this recipe.
  • For the sweetener you can use maple syrup, honey, or agave nectar.
  • You can use bottled lemon juice in a pinch.
  • This recipe can be doubled or multiplied and served in a pitcher.

Storage Tips

SERVE: You can keep the drink out for about two hours before it needs to be refrigerated.

STORE: Keep leftovers in the refrigerator for up to two days.

Recipe FAQs

Is Starbucks dragonfruit refresher healthy?

Eh, kind of. The natural sweetener and fruit helps make this a pretty healthy drink. 

Is there caffeine in Dragonfruit refresher?

There is caffeine in this recipe. If you would like to have it without caffeine you will need to substitute something for the green tea. You can try using soda water or coconut water as some options. However, it will change the taste of the recipe when you do this.

What’s in a Starbucks dragon fruit refresher?

The ingredients in my copycat Starbucks Dragonfruit refresher include fresh dragonfruit, ice, lemonade, green tea, and maple syrup. Combine it all for a refreshing summer pick-me-up!

Pink Dragonfruit Refresher

Course Drinks
Prep Time 10 mins
Total Time 10 mins
Servings 2 people
Prevent your screen from going dark
Cold, refreshing, and naturally-sweetened pink dragonfruit refresher that has the perfect amount of pucker. Recipe inspired by Starbuck's Dragon Drink.
Print Recipe
Pin Recipe
Share Recipe

Ingredients
 

  • ¾ cup fresh or frozen pink dragonfruit mashed
  • ½ cup fresh lemon juice about 2 lemons
  • 1 cup of brewed green tea that has cooled
  • ¼ cup pure maple syrup

Instructions

  • Brew 1 cup of tea. Set aside to cool.
  • Squeeze the lemons and strain to get rid of the pulp (getting rid of the pulp, optional). Set aside. 
  • Mash the pink dragonfruit with a fork until the desired consistency is met. If you don’t want it to be chunky, simply blend the fruit until it’s nice and creamy. Now we will put it all together. 
  • Add the lemon juice, maple syrup, and cooled green tea together. Stir to combine.  Now we will assemble the drink.
  • On the bottom of the glass add the dragonfruit, followed by ice-filled to the rim, then the green tea lemonade. Finally, top the glass with more dragonfruit. 
  • Enjoy right away!
